Неправильный путь сборки нефритовых маршрутов - PullRequest
0 голосов
/ 27 февраля 2019

Моя домашняя страница, созданная с помощью jade-шаблона, успешно добавила jade-файлы в html.Однако в моем app.js мой templateUrl не отражает изменения, которые должны быть 'partials/home.html вместо partials/home.У меня возникает эта проблема при запуске производственных файлов, домашняя страница которых не найдена.Как мне решить эту проблему путем преобразования в partials/home.html.

app.js

myApp.config(['$routeProvider','$locationProvider','$httpProvider', 
function ($routeProvider, $locationProvider, $httpProvider) {
   $locationProvider.html5Mode(true).hashPrefix('!');
   $httpProvider.interceptors.push('APIInterceptor');
   $routeProvider
    .when('/', {
        templateUrl: 'partials/home',
        controller: 'HomeController'
    })
})

Gruntfile.js

grunt.registerTask('build', [
    'clean', 'jade',
    'copy:html', 'copy:main', 'copy:vendorJS',
    'html2js',
    'useminPrepare',
    'concat', 
    'uglify',
    'cssmin',
    'rev', 
    'copy:vendorCSS', 
    'copy:vendorJS', 
    'copy:images',
    'usemin'
]);

Спасибо.

...